Job Description
- Monitor live GPU cluster health power cooling networking and infrastructure status across production deployments.
- Triage troubleshoot and resolve incidents while maintaining SLA requirements.
- Identify infrastructure issues early and take proactive action before they become customer-impacting incidents.
- Escalate appropriate issues to OEMs data center operators network providers or other Tier 3 partners.
- Build and improve internal monitoring tools scripts and automation to reduce repetitive manual work.
- Use Python Bash or similar scripting tools to automate monitoring triage reporting and operational workflows.
- Explore and implement AI-enabled workflows that improve NOC speed accuracy and efficiency.
- Create maintain and continuously improve technical runbooks and standard operating procedures.
- Participate in incident reviews and turn recurring problems into permanent tooling process or automation improvements.
- Track SLA and incident metrics and identify opportunities to improve reliability and response times.
- Communicate clearly and proactively with customers and internal stakeholders during incidents.
- Coordinate with data center operators OEMs network providers and other third parties to resolve customer-impacting issues.
- Support a 24/7 rotating operations schedule including nights weekends and other assigned shifts.
Qualifications
- 2 years of experience in a NOC network operations infrastructure monitoring or related technical operations environment.
- Direct experience supporting or monitoring GPU HPC AI infrastructure or comparable high-performance computing environments.
- Hands-on Python or Bash scripting experience.
- Experience with infrastructure monitoring and alerting tools such as Datadog Grafana PagerDuty or similar platforms.
- Strong troubleshooting and incident-response skills.
- Experience working with network compute storage or data center infrastructure.
- Ability to understand technical issues quickly and communicate effectively during incidents.
- Demonstrated interest in automation scripting tool-building and continuous operational improvement.
- Must be comfortable working rotating 24/7 shifts including nights and weekends.
- Ability to work independently in a remote environment while collaborating effectively with global technical teams.
- Additional languages beyond English are a plus.
